### 600+ Failed Emergency Calls in Telstra Outage Raise Public Health Alarm
2026-07-23 23:32:24 · Sector: health · Sentiment: Strongly negative · Impact: 9/10 · Sources: 6

The Telstra network failure on July 8, 2026, caused over 600 failed calls to Australia's emergency number 000, highlighting critical vulnerabilities in accessing urgent medical assistance and the reliance of telehealth and health monitoring on reliable communications.

### Two Telstra Outages in 24 Hrs Halt Freight Rail, Disrupt 25M Services
2026-07-12 13:02:02 · Sector: supply · Sentiment: Negative · Impact: 6/10 · Sources: 3

Telstra's dual network failures within 24 hours crippled freight rail and digital payment systems across Australia, exposing the fragility of supply chain connectivity. With 25 million mobile services affected, logistics operators face prolonged uncertainty as root causes remain unexplained.
